Spurs fans were treated to the news this week that the club have joined Manchester United and PSG in chasing Roma wonderkid Nicolo Zaniolo, with the Italian reportedly top of Jose Mourinho’s transfer list. 

According to the Daily Express (via Ricky Sacks), the 20-year-old is a serious target for the new Spurs boss as he looks for a long-term replacement for Christian Eriksen. The youngster has made 17 appearances for Roma so far this season; averaging a 6.9 rating for Paulo Fonseca’s side.

With Eriksen possibly departing in the summer, Zaniolo could be the ideal man to replace the Danish international, with the 20-year-old having already established himself as a regular for the Serie A giants despite his tender age. However, it seems as if Spurs will face stiff competition from the likes of Manchester United and PSG in securing the services of Zaniolo, so it may be tough for Mourinho to bring in the £36 million-rated man in January.

Zaniolo is certainly a target for the future, although a creative midfielder may not be what Spurs need at the moment. The Italian has especially impressed in the Europa League this season, with two goals and two assists in the four games Roma have played in the competition. However, it seems unlikely that Daniel Levy would sanction a move for the £36 million rated youngster when they already have the likes of Giovani Lo Celso and Dele Alli at the club.
